Roman coinage represents the largest single category of object recorded through the British Museum s Portable Antiquities Scheme (PAS), with over 300,000 single finds in addition to several thousand hoards. This dataset, unparalleled anywhere else in the world, provides a unique perspective on the province of Roman Britain and its interaction with the larger Roman Empire. By exploring 50 key finds of Roman coinage it is possible to shed light on all aspects of Roman Britain from the conquest in AD 43 through to the Roman withdrawal by c. AD 410. Unusually for a Roman numismatic dataset, the PAS examples provide wide coverage of the entire province, revealing evidence for early military activity, the development of the rural landscape, as well as the socio-political and cultural evolution of the province. Dr Andrew Brown has a PhD in Archaeology from the University of Bristol. He spent eight years as Finds Liaison Officer in Suffolk before taking up post as Assistant National Finds Advisor for Iron Age and Roman Coinage at the British Museum. Andrew has published on Roman coinage as well as the archaeology of Suffolk, the Mediterranean, and Anatolia.
